# Runbook: Fabrikit test-data factory

Fabrikit seeds deterministic fixtures for the Ostermill suite. If builds fail with duplicate-key errors, the sequence counter has drifted — reset it via the admin task, never by hand-editing the seed table. Factories are registered at import time; a missing registration usually means a circular import in the traits module. Regenerate snapshots only on the CI runner to keep checksums stable. The library reads its runtime settings from the block below:

settings of bafof-fajog:
[aldix]
port = 9300
region = north-3
host = aldix.kelvilabs.example
team = istath
timeout_ms = 1500
retries = 8

## Formula sandbox tuning

User-supplied formulas in Gridmoor execute inside a restricted interpreter with hard ceilings on time, memory, and call depth. Reviewers should confirm any change to these ceilings is justified in the PR description, since raising them widens the abuse surface. Defaults were chosen from production traces. The current limits are as follows.

limits module of tafog-fawip:
WEIGHTS = {
    "julix": 57,
    "lamys": 992,
    "kasvan": 209,
    "quenok": 750,
    "alddor": 259,
    "oliath": 1009,
    "wenix": 815,
}

Capacity note for the Bramblewick export retry queue. Failed exports are requeued with exponential backoff, and the queue depth is our main capacity signal: sustained depth above the high-water mark means downstream Pellis storage is saturated, not that we need more workers. As the new contractor, please don't raise worker counts without checking storage latency first — it usually makes things worse. Retry timing, backoff caps, and the high-water threshold are all driven by the constants shown below.

limits module of yagef-bajog:
TIERS = {
    "druael": 370,
    "tamix": 286,
    "pelius": 541,
    "pelael": 78,
    "pelox": 47,
    "ralath": 533,
    "drumir": 801,
}